145 So. 3d 664
Miss.2014Background
- 1987 Bagley purchased a cancer and dread-disease policy through agent McPhail, issued by American Heritage Life Insurance Company.
- Policy is a cancer and dread-disease reimbursement policy, not a life-insurance policy with a named beneficiary right.
- In 2008 Bagley was diagnosed with cancer and sought to change the beneficiary to the Straits; McPhail attempted to complete a change-of-beneficiary form but never finalized it due to Hurricane Fay and lack of contact with American Heritage.
- Bagley signed the form intending to name the Straits; the form did not list the Straits as beneficiaries at the time of signing.
- Bagley died before the form could be completed; the policy proceeds ultimately went to Bagley’s estate as indicated by the policy terms and probate proceedings.
- In 2009 the estate sought to include the policy proceeds in its final accounting; the Straits pursued litigation alleging multiple causes of action, which the circuit court dismissed, and the Court of Appeals later reversed before certiorari was granted.
Issues
| Issue | Plaintiff's Argument | Defendant's Argument | Held |
|---|---|---|---|
| Whether the Straits may recover as third-party beneficiaries to the policy. | Straits were intended beneficiaries of Bagley’s policy. | Policy did not provide for beneficiary designation or change; Straits cannot be named beneficiaries. | Straits have no viable third-party-beneficiary entitlement under the policy. |
| Whether any genuine issues of material fact exist to support relief. | Questions remain about McPhail’s conduct and policy administration. | Policy terms bar beneficiary change and related duties; no material facts support relief. | No genuine issues of material fact; relief not warranted. |
